Top 5 Casual Games on iOS in Australia for Q3 2022

During the third quarter of 2022, the top 5 casual games on iOS in Australia showcased varying trends in we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at their performance, based on data from Sensor Tower.

Subway Surfers from Sybo Games ApS experienced a steady decline in weekly revenue, starting at around $20K at the end of June and dropping to approximately $2.8K by the end of September. Weekly downloads also saw a downward trend, beginning with 28.2K and decreasing to 10.7K. Active users followed a similar pattern, starting at 879K and dipping to 649K by the end of Q3.

Fishdom by Playrix maintained relatively stable weekly revenue throughout the quarter, fluctuating between $92K and $108K. Downloads peaked at 16K in late August but eventually fell to 8.7K by the end of September. Active users ranged from 62K to 73K, showing slight fluctuations but overall stability.

Makeup Kit - Color Mixing from Crazy Labs saw a significant surge in weekly downloads after its release in mid-July, peaking at 29K in early August. However, downloads decreased sharply to 4.8K by the end of September. The number of active users also saw a rise, starting at 12 in mid-July and reaching 41.7K in late August, before dropping to 14.8K by the end of the quarter.

Wordle! by Lion Studios Plus had a relatively stable revenue, hovering around $4.5K to $5K for most of the quarter, with a slight dip to $2.8K in early September. Weekly downloads fluctuated, starting at 12.2K at the end of June, peaking at 15.4K in early July, and ending at 7.8K in late September. Active users showed a similar trend, ranging between 58K and 79K.

Among Us! by InnerSloth LLC displayed modest weekly revenue, generally below $1K, with a peak of $1.1K in mid-September. Downloads were fairly consistent, starting at 12.6K and ending at 9.5K. Active users started at 33.4K in late June, dipped to 14.9K in early September, and then rose again to 29.6K by the end of the quarter.
